 M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if. — July 19, 2016 — Based on its recent analysis of the video analytics market, Frost & Sullivan recognizes Vidyard with the 2016 North America Frost & Sullivan Award for Customer Value Leadership. Vidyard’s advanced video hosting platform with deep analytics and built-in marketing and sales tools has emerged as the ideal solution to support customers’ marketing, demand generation, sales, and internal communications. Vidyard’s platform works with existing customer relationship management (CRM) and marketing automation software (MAS) solutions to offer comprehensive video analytics for superior lead generation.

Apart from basic performance tracking metrics such as a video’s total number of views, Vidyard’s solution includes value additions such as demographic data regarding the viewer, the duration of a view, as well as analytics data. This enhanced insight into the viewer helps generate more responsive leads and gives companies a realistic idea of the influence of their marketing strategy on each viewer.

“Vidyard allows marketers to seamlessly weave an individual viewer’s name, title, company name, company logo, or other unique content into the video itself for a more engaging message,” said Frost & Sullivan Industry Manager, Aravindh Vanchesan. “This way, companies can build a stronger connection with each viewer or ask questions that create a dialogue instead of communicating one-way.”

Companies that upload videos to the Vidyard platform can easily share them by pushing them to any social media channel or embedding them on any Web page using Vidyard’s HTML-5 video player. The player is brandable and features real-time viewing numbers, custom ‘call to action’ and email gate options, as well as split-testing abilities.

Vidyard tracks viewers who load the video player with a unique ID generated through the browser in localStorage or browser cookies. Its server receives the data and transports it to the company along with metadata such as the viewer’s email address, device type, and geolocation. Companies can access the Analytics Center through the Vidyard Dashboard using a distinct company ID which is assigned to several users with specific permissions. Analytics on the dashboard are searchable and filtered by the metadata information to pinpoint the individual and measure their attention span.

Vidyard’s strategy to provide the most-efficient and easy-to-use analytics solution involves partnerships and integrations with popular CRM and MAS tools. By building relationships with conglomerates such as Salesforce, Marketo, Eloqua, Google, and Adobe, Vidyard’s analytics show how videos impact prospect qualification for more efficient business strategies and how deals are closing in the sales pipeline.

In addition to working with existing CRM and MAS solutions, Vidyard creates a valued ecosystem of the best solutions across the board, which will enable it to stand out among future video analytics providers. Vidyard showcases its analytics solution as a resource that generates more business value, instead of just promoting it as a hosting solution.

“By appealing to the operations, sales, and marketing experts of a company, Vidyard demonstrates that analytics is at the center of every company’s business strategy,” noted Vanchesan. “Furthermore, it markets the platform as the portal between the systems that impact sales and marketing strategies. The value that it offers customers through its exceptional analytics solution translates into return on investment and a high-quality customer experience.”

Each year, Frost & Sullivan presents this award to the company that has demonstrated excellence in implementing strategies that proactively create value for its customers with a focus on improving the return on the investment that customers make in its services or products. The award recognises the company’s inordinate focus on enhancing the value that its customers receive, beyond simply good customer service, leading to improved customer retention and ultimately customer base expansion.

Frost & Sullivan Best Practices awards recognize companies in a variety of regional and global markets for demonstrating outstanding achievement and superior performance in areas such as leadership, technological innovation, customer service, and strategic product development. Industry analysts compare market participants and measure performance through in-depth interviews, analysis, and extensive secondary research to identify best practices in the industry.

About Vidyard

Vidyard (Twitter: @Vidyard) is the video intelligence platform that helps businesses drive more revenue through the use of online video. Going beyond video hosting and management, Vidyard helps businesses drive greater engagement in their video content, track the viewing activities of each individual viewer, and turn those views into action. Global leaders such as Honeywell, McKesson, Lenovo, LinkedIn, Cision, TD Ameritrade, Citibank, MongoDB and Sharp rely on Vidyard to power their video content strategies and turn viewer into customers.
